Factors to Consider When Choosing Mental Health Self-care Kits
Choosing the right mental health self-care kit depends on several key factors. Not all kits are equally suited to every individual, so understanding what to look for can help you make an informed decision. From the type of tools included to the ease of use, each element impacts how well the kit supports your mental wellness journey. Consider these factors carefully to find a kit that aligns with your goals and lifestyle.Purpose and Focus
Determine what mental health aspect you want to target—whether it’s anxiety, depression, stress relief, or overall mindfulness. Some kits are tailored specifically for anxiety management, offering tools like grounding cards, while others focus on building resilience through journaling or positive affirmations. Clarifying your main goal will help you select a kit that provides the most relevant resources.Content and Variety
Assess the types of tools included—journals, cards, stickers, or planners—and whether they complement each other. A well-rounded kit offers multiple formats to engage different senses and reinforce positive habits. Be wary of kits that only include a single type of resource, as they may lack the depth needed for sustained self-care.Ease of Use
Look for kits with straightforward instructions and accessible tools, especially if you’re new to self-care practices. Kits that are overly complex or require prior knowledge can discourage consistent use. Simplicity often translates to higher engagement and more meaningful benefits over time.Quality and Durability

How do I choose a self-care kit suited for my specific mental health needs?
Start by identifying your main mental health concerns, whether it’s anxiety, depression, or stress management. Look for kits that focus explicitly on those areas, offering targeted tools like grounding exercises or mood tracking. Consider your comfort level with self-guided practices—if you prefer structured routines, a journal might be best; if you want quick stress-relief tools, cards or stickers could work well. Matching the kit’s focus with your personal goals improves the chances of sustained use and benefits.Are self-care kits effective without professional guidance?
Self-care kits can be valuable supplemental tools for managing daily stress and emotional well-being, but they are not substitutes for professional therapy when needed. Many kits include evidence-based techniques like mindfulness or cognitive behavioral strategies, which can support your mental health journey. However, if you’re experiencing severe symptoms or crises, consulting a mental health professional is essential for appropriate care and guidance.How often should I use my self-care kit to see benefits?
Consistency is key for seeing meaningful benefits from a self-care kit. Incorporating daily or regular use—such as journaling in the morning or using grounding cards during stressful moments—helps build habits that support mental resilience. Even short daily practices can reinforce positive thinking and emotional regulation over time.
